Lights Football Win Season Opener

Story of the Game:
The MSU-Northern Lights played Mayville State University on August 26 in the afternoon in Havre, Montana.  The Lights beat the Comets 14-0.  Northern tallied 191 yards of total offense (145 passing and 46 rushing), while the Comets accounted for 157, of which 145 yards were in the air. 

Individual Stats:
Northern quarterback Oakley Kopp went 17 for 24 through the air for 145 yards. Mason Dionne carried the ball 13 times for 28 yards. Devin Shelton had four catches on the afternoon for 42 yards. Lucas Thacker had nine total tackles. Devin Carmona added seven tackles and two sacks.

Mayville State University quarterback Tim Salmon went 15 of 32 through the air for 132 yards. Mason Ollman had a net rushing yard of 15 with 10 attempts. Xyler Carlson received six passes at 45 yards.
